Sandoz awards account

Sandoz Agro Canada has awarded its $2-million account to Marketing Communication of London, Ont. after a four-month review.

The Mississauga, Ont.-based Sandoz began the review with 24 agencies in the running, and ended with a short-list of three, including Griffin Bacal Volny of Toronto and Ginty Jocius & Associates of Guelph, Ont.

In February of this year, Sandoz Agro ended a seven-year relationship with Quarry Communications of Waterloo, Ont.

The split was amicable and precipitated by a conflict between Sandoz, which makes agricultural herbicides, and a product to be launched by another Quarry client.

Marketing Communication will be working on Sandoz products such as Frontier, a weed control product for corn and soybeans, introduced earlier this year, and Clarity, a broadleaf weed control product for corn, which is undergoing registration in Canada before its launch.

Swiss-based parent company Sandoz operates in 56 countries, producing pharmaceuticals, industrial chemicals, dyestuffs, specialty foods, seeds and agrochemicals.

It recently agreed to buy giant baby food company Gerber Foods for US$3.7 billion.
